HH Khalid bin Hamad Congratulates HM King and HRH Crown Prince on National Volleyball Team’s Arab Championship Win.

Manama: His Highness Shaikh Khalid bin Hamad Al Khalifa, First Deputy Chairman of the Supreme Council for Youth and Sports, President of the General Sports Authority, and President of the Bahrain Olympic Committee congratulated His Majesty King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a; His Royal Highness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, the Crown Prince and Prime Minister; and His Highness Shaikh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a, Representative of His Majesty for Humanitarian Works and Youth Affairs and Chairman of the Supreme Council for Youth and Sports, on the national volleyball team's victory at the 23rd Arab Championship, following their win over Qatar, three sets to one, in the final match. According to Bahrain News Agency, His Highness commended this Arab-level achievement, further enhancing Bahrain's sporting record and demonstrating the strength and distinction of the national volleyball teams in competitions regionally and internationally. He also congratulated the Chairman and members of the Bahrain Volleyball Fed eration. HH Shaikh Khalid praised the team's performance and high technical skill throughout the tournament, where they honourably represented Bahrain with commitment and determination. He highlighted that this achievement reflects the efforts of the Bahrain Volleyball Federation, the support from His Majesty the King and His Royal Highness the Crown Prince and Prime Minister for the sports and youth sector, along with the players' dedication, the role of the coaching and administrative teams, and the supporters, all of which contributed to this success and status of Bahraini volleyball. HH Shaikh Khalid wished the national team would continue to achieve further success.
